Things to do in Kuantan & Kemaman during school holidays:

1. Stumbled upon this road side durian stall before our accommodation is ready for check in. Have super nice durian though I’m not big fan of durian.

P6133488P6133492 P6133489

  2. Drove 15 mins to Teluk Cempedak (the nearest beach to Kuantan town), soak under sun, dip your feet in the clear water, camwhore & doing the compulsory jump-shot thingy :)

P6133497P6133501P6133503P6133505   

3. After a tiring playtime by the beach, it’s time to continue makan. 5 mins walk from the beach, there’s this awesome curry laksa recommended by wikitravel. (Sorry lar, forgot what name)

P6133512P6133506

Oh, excuse me – allow me to add, THEY SERVED THE BESTEST TEH-O-AIS I’VE EVER TRIED!!! we had like – 8 glasses of them??

4.   Checked into a private run hotel, it’s a double story house converted to a place to stay. Privacy of a house, comfort and facilities of a hotel. wahlau, damn nice!

5. In the evening, continue the makan marathon by driving 1 hour to Kemaman. Have the famous Hai Peng coffee. How good it is? Hah! It is bloody-extremely-freaking-super duper-damn-f***king good!! I can’t describe how good it is in word, you just gotta go try it yourself. The coffee is damn good, the nasi dagang is awesome, the rotibakar is excellent, damn, even the french fries is freaking tasty!

6. On the way back from Kemaman to Kuantan, you’ll pass by some pasar malam. Do stop over and have some durians, keropok lekor, fried chicken drumstick @ RM 1 per pc, cheap!

7. Just 15 mins after the pasar malam stop, you’ll see Pak Su Seafood Restaurant at the left of Jalan Berserah. Yeah, by this time, we were so full already but we just gotta try since they are famous for Stuffed Crab.
